Transaction 250716693ae6fcb4d841f770f6083cc4aba8593a86bb503228bc1a523e78c395

1 Input
2 Outputs
  • 250716693ae6fcb4d841f770f6083cc4aba8593a86bb503228bc1a523e78c395:0
  • value  163153
    address  14s2m2FqkEjzUdmECaQHayxXg7SncBtnL6
  • 250716693ae6fcb4d841f770f6083cc4aba8593a86bb503228bc1a523e78c395:1
  • value  507939
    address  1Mw8uh7BmpPBJYANDJtTp5d8AC4ErWHutX